## Metrics Sidecar (Copperfen Agent)

The Copperfen sidecar aggregates per-pod metrics before forwarding them to the central Dellwyn collector. It runs unprivileged, mounts no host paths, and communicates only over the internal mesh. All scrape intervals and egress limits are pinned at deploy time. For your review, the complete set of enforced configuration values appears below.

settings of tagef-bawif:
DRUIX_HOST=druix.zemvarlabs.internal
DRUIX_PORT=8000

## Idempotency Keys for Payment Retries (Lumopay)

Every retry of a charge request must reuse the original idempotency key; generating a new key on retry can produce duplicate charges. Keys are scoped per merchant and expire after 48 hours. Reviewers should verify keys are derived server-side, never from client input. The full key-generation specification and threat model are maintained on the internal page.

dashboard of kaguf-tawip = https://vault.merlaqsys.test/issue

Hey night crew — quick handover before I head out. The server room at Tallowmere House is getting its cooling unit swapped tonight, so the vendor techs from Copperline Mechanical will be in and out until about 02:00. Check their names against the list on the clipboard and walk them down yourself; don't buzz them through remotely. Once the work wraps, make sure the inner door relatches. The keypad code for tonight is below.

badge for fafop-fajof: bdg-Z-47

MINUTES — Management Sync, Training Budget FY Next

Attendees: Priya, Oskar, Dena, Marcos.

Quick one, folks. We agreed to bump the sales training budget roughly 15%, mostly for the new Quellford negotiation course and refreshed onboarding for the Vantrey product line. Dena will rank requests by region; Oskar owns the vendor shortlist. Nothing's locked until the Q1 board review, so don't promise your teams anything yet. Context on why we're investing now is in the note below.

internal memo for faweg-tafog: Only 7 of the 100 pilot accounts renewed Quenael, so a churn review is set for April 15.